He was subsequently offered a trial in February 2010, joining the first team for a number of weeks and taking part to their training sessions; in order to defy journalists from his real identity, Sabatini referred him to the journalists using the name of "Gonzalez". On 31 August 2010 Palermo confirmed the signing of Jara Martínez from Nacional Asunción. The player immediately joined the under-19 youth team, but only made his competitive debut later on November due to bureaucratic issues. Since then, the player has trained occasionally with the first-team squad, and also appeared on the bench for a number of Serie A games.
